Commit Graph

  • 0e43495d3b tests/9pfs: check fid being unaffected in fs_walk_2nd_nonexistent Christian Schoenebeck 2022-03-15 11:08:47 +01:00
  • 15fbff488a tests/9pfs: guard recent 'Twalk' behaviour fix Christian Schoenebeck 2022-03-15 11:08:41 +01:00
  • a93d2e89e5 9pfs: fix 'Twalk' to only send error if no component walked Christian Schoenebeck 2022-03-15 11:08:39 +01:00
  • fd6c979e65 9pfs: refactor 'name_idx' -> 'nwalked' in v9fs_walk() Christian Schoenebeck 2022-03-15 11:08:37 +01:00
  • a6821b8284 tests/9pfs: compare QIDs in fs_walk_none() test Christian Schoenebeck 2022-03-15 11:08:35 +01:00
  • c1668948e8 tests/9pfs: Twalk with nwname=0 Christian Schoenebeck 2022-03-15 11:08:33 +01:00
  • 9472a68965 tests/9pfs: walk to non-existent dir Christian Schoenebeck 2022-03-15 11:08:30 +01:00
  • 7147170240
    New hooks for libafl_qemu (#673) Andrea Fioraldi 2022-06-16 11:09:07 +02:00
  • 03e283c858
    fix build for ARM target (#4) Michael Rodler 2022-06-16 11:04:17 +02:00
  • ac7bfe4325 Merge remote-tracking branch 'upstream/master' into main Andrea Fioraldi 2022-06-16 10:56:25 +02:00
  • caab57fafd
    New hooks (#7) Andrea Fioraldi 2022-06-16 10:55:57 +02:00
  • 9ac873a469 Merge tag 'block-pull-request' of https://gitlab.com/stefanha/qemu into staging Richard Henderson 2022-06-15 09:47:24 -07:00
  • 99b969fbe1 linux-aio: explain why max batch is checked in laio_io_unplug() Stefan Hajnoczi 2022-06-09 17:47:12 +01:00
  • f387cac5af linux-aio: fix unbalanced plugged counter in laio_io_unplug() Stefan Hajnoczi 2022-06-09 17:47:11 +01:00
  • 78e27dfa8d vfio-user: handle reset of remote device Jagannathan Raman 2022-06-13 16:26:34 -04:00
  • 08cf3dc611 vfio-user: handle device interrupts Jagannathan Raman 2022-06-13 16:26:33 -04:00
  • 3123f93d6b vfio-user: handle PCI BAR accesses Jagannathan Raman 2022-06-13 16:26:32 -04:00
  • 15ccf9bee7 vfio-user: handle DMA mappings Jagannathan Raman 2022-06-13 16:26:31 -04:00
  • 253007d147 vfio-user: IOMMU support for remote device Jagannathan Raman 2022-06-13 16:26:30 -04:00
  • 90072f29d6 vfio-user: handle PCI config space accesses Jagannathan Raman 2022-06-13 16:26:29 -04:00
  • 9fb3fba149 vfio-user: run vfio-user context Jagannathan Raman 2022-06-13 16:26:28 -04:00
  • a6e8d6d98e vfio-user: find and init PCI device Jagannathan Raman 2022-06-13 16:26:27 -04:00
  • 87f7249ff6 vfio-user: instantiate vfio-user context Jagannathan Raman 2022-06-13 16:26:26 -04:00
  • 8f9a9259d3 vfio-user: define vfio-user-server object Jagannathan Raman 2022-06-13 16:26:25 -04:00
  • 55116968de vfio-user: build library Jagannathan Raman 2022-06-13 16:26:24 -04:00
  • 9b5b473eae remote/machine: add vfio-user property Jagannathan Raman 2022-06-13 16:26:23 -04:00
  • 661e21c48e remote/machine: add HotplugHandler for remote machine Jagannathan Raman 2022-06-13 16:26:22 -04:00
  • 217c7f01ad qdev: unplug blocker for devices Jagannathan Raman 2022-06-13 16:26:21 -04:00
  • e2848bc574 Use io_uring_register_ring_fd() to skip fd operations Sam Li 2022-05-31 18:50:11 +08:00
  • 9e4067b8a4 MAINTAINERS: update Vladimir's address and repositories Vladimir Sementsov-Ogievskiy 2022-05-26 14:54:32 +03:00
  • 76ca98b0f8 build: include pc-bios/ part in the ROMS variable Paolo Bonzini 2022-04-13 15:22:01 +02:00
  • 12640f05eb meson: put cross compiler info in a separate section Paolo Bonzini 2022-06-06 11:48:47 +02:00
  • 766a981474 q35:Enable TSEG only when G_SMRAME and TSEG_EN both enabled Zhenzhong Duan 2022-06-15 11:45:01 +08:00
  • aa4f3a3b88 build: fix check for -fsanitize-coverage-allowlist Alexander Bulekov 2022-06-14 11:54:15 -04:00
  • 39735a914d tests/vm: allow running tests in an unconfigured source tree Paolo Bonzini 2022-06-14 18:36:34 +02:00
  • b9eae9efae configure: cleanup -fno-pie detection Paolo Bonzini 2022-03-29 13:07:25 +02:00
  • aa7d78affe finish eval scripts Alwin Berger 2022-06-14 23:54:47 +02:00
  • b5569e5b56 configure: update list of preserved environment variables Paolo Bonzini 2022-06-07 12:14:47 +02:00
  • 26cfd67981 virtio-mmio: cleanup reset Paolo Bonzini 2022-06-09 08:54:54 +02:00
  • 9e43a83041 virtio: stop ioeventfd on reset Paolo Bonzini 2022-06-09 08:41:14 +02:00
  • a44bed2f54 virtio-mmio: stop ioeventfd on legacy reset Paolo Bonzini 2022-06-09 08:49:21 +02:00
  • 997340f3c5 s390x: simplify virtio_ccw_reset_virtio Paolo Bonzini 2022-06-09 08:35:45 +02:00
  • f55ba8018c block: add more commands to preconfig mode Paolo Bonzini 2020-11-03 04:37:20 -05:00
  • 39cd0c7f12 hmp: add filtering of statistics by name Paolo Bonzini 2022-04-26 14:09:31 +02:00
  • cf7405bc02 qmp: add filtering of statistics by name Paolo Bonzini 2022-05-24 19:13:16 +02:00
  • 7716417eac hmp: add filtering of statistics by provider Paolo Bonzini 2022-04-26 13:58:59 +02:00
  • 068cc51d42 qmp: add filtering of statistics by provider Paolo Bonzini 2022-04-26 11:49:33 +02:00
  • 433815f5bd hmp: add basic "info stats" implementation Mark Kanda 2022-04-26 12:17:35 +02:00
  • cfb3448922 cutils: add functions for IEC and SI prefixes Paolo Bonzini 2022-05-25 15:38:48 +02:00
  • 467ef823d8 qmp: add filtering of statistics by target vCPU Paolo Bonzini 2022-04-26 14:59:44 +02:00
  • cc01a3f4ca kvm: Support for querying fd-based stats Mark Kanda 2022-02-15 09:04:33 -06:00
  • b9f88dc071 qmp: Support for querying stats Mark Kanda 2022-02-15 09:04:31 -06:00
  • d35020ed00 bsd-user: Implement acct and sync Warner Losh 2022-06-12 09:31:18 -06:00
  • 4b795b147b bsd-user: Implement trunctate and ftruncate Warner Losh 2022-06-12 09:29:02 -06:00
  • a15699acaf bsd-user: Implement dup and dup2 Warner Losh 2022-06-12 09:27:19 -06:00
  • 6af8f76a9f bsd-user: Implement rmdir and undocumented __getcwd Warner Losh 2022-06-12 08:23:57 -06:00
  • 1ffbd5e7fe bsd-user: Implement mkdir and mkdirat Warner Losh 2022-06-12 08:21:01 -06:00
  • 8e6c70b9d4 Merge tag 'kraxel-20220614-pull-request' of git://git.kraxel.org/qemu into staging Richard Henderson 2022-06-14 06:21:46 -07:00
  • 93048f6270
    Add custom GDB commands to libafl_qemu (#671) Andrea Fioraldi 2022-06-14 11:45:14 +02:00
  • f7c997ec65
    CustomBuf Events to exchange any data between fuzzers (#672) Dominik Maier 2022-06-14 11:10:08 +02:00
  • b95b56311a virtio-gpu: Respect UI refresh rate for EDID Akihiko Odaki 2022-02-26 20:55:16 +09:00
  • aeffd071ed ui: Deliver refresh rate via QemuUIInfo Akihiko Odaki 2022-02-26 20:55:15 +09:00
  • 362239c05f ui/console: Do not return a value with ui_info Akihiko Odaki 2022-02-26 20:55:14 +09:00
  • 45e64ab63d virtio-gpu: update done only on the scanout associated with rect Dongwon Kim 2022-05-05 14:40:30 -07:00
  • 0631d4b448 usbredir: avoid queuing hello packet on snapshot restore Joelle van Dyne 2022-05-06 21:18:50 -07:00
  • f471e8b060 hw/usb/hcd-ehci: fix writeback order Arnout Engelen 2022-05-08 17:32:22 +02:00
  • 5028d66cb2 MAINTAINERS: add myself as CanoKey maintainer Hongren (Zenithal) Zheng 2022-05-19 20:40:55 +08:00
  • adaf4d2e84 docs/system/devices/usb: Add CanoKey to USB devices examples Hongren (Zenithal) Zheng 2022-05-19 20:40:03 +08:00
  • 994e735c83 docs: Add CanoKey documentation Hongren (Zenithal) Zheng 2022-05-19 20:39:38 +08:00
  • 8caef85078 meson: Add CanoKey Hongren (Zenithal) Zheng 2022-05-19 20:38:57 +08:00
  • d37d0e0e85 hw/usb/canokey: Add trace events Hongren (Zenithal) Zheng 2022-05-19 20:38:30 +08:00
  • d7d3491855 hw/usb: Add CanoKey Implementation Hongren (Zenithal) Zheng 2022-05-19 20:38:10 +08:00
  • 2910abd6b4 ui/cocoa: Fix poweroff request code Akihiko Odaki 2022-05-29 17:25:08 +09:00
  • 09053670c9 ui/gtk-gl-area: create the requested GL context version Volker Rümelin 2022-06-05 10:51:31 +02:00
  • e561b3b7df ui/gtk-gl-area: implement GL context destruction Volker Rümelin 2022-06-05 10:51:30 +02:00
  • debd075366 Merge tag 'pull-testing-next-140622-1' of https://github.com/stsquad/qemu into staging Richard Henderson 2022-06-13 21:10:57 -07:00
  • b56d1ee951 .gitlab: use less aggressive nproc on our aarch64/32 runners Alex Bennée 2022-06-13 18:12:58 +01:00
  • 34776d80f3 gitlab: compare CIRRUS_nn vars against 'null' not "" Daniel P. Berrangé 2022-06-13 18:12:57 +01:00
  • c48a5c4741 tests/tcg: disable xtensa-linux-user again Paolo Bonzini 2022-06-13 18:12:56 +01:00
  • ab698a4d8b tests/docker: fix the IMAGE for build invocation Alex Bennée 2022-06-13 18:12:55 +01:00
  • 72ec89bfc5 gitlab-ci: Fix the build-cfi-aarch64 and build-cfi-ppc64-s390x jobs Thomas Huth 2022-06-13 18:12:54 +01:00
  • 6012d96379 tests/tcg/i386: Use explicit suffix on fist insns Richard Henderson 2022-06-13 18:12:53 +01:00
  • b2df786170 test/tcg/arm: Use -mfloat-abi=soft for test-armv6m-undef Richard Henderson 2022-06-13 18:12:52 +01:00
  • 2d3b7e01d6 bsd-user: Implement link, linkat, unlink and unlinkat Warner Losh 2022-06-12 08:18:48 -06:00
  • ab5fd2d969 bsd-user: Implement rename and renameat Warner Losh 2022-06-12 08:16:46 -06:00
  • 390f547ea8 bsd-user: Implement chdir and fchdir Warner Losh 2022-06-12 08:13:34 -06:00
  • 65c6c4c893 bsd-user: Implement revoke, access, eaccess and faccessat Warner Losh 2022-06-12 08:11:30 -06:00
  • a2ba6c7b80 bsd-user: Implement fdatasync, fsync and close_from Warner Losh 2022-06-12 08:07:39 -06:00
  • 77d3522b3f bsd-user: Implement open, openat and close Warner Losh 2022-06-11 21:32:19 -06:00
  • dcb40541eb Merge tag 'mips-20220611' of https://github.com/philmd/qemu into staging Richard Henderson 2022-06-11 21:13:27 -07:00
  • b871cc83d6 Merge tag 'bsd-user-preen-2022q2-pull-request' of ssh://github.com/qemu-bsd-user/qemu-bsd-user into staging Richard Henderson 2022-06-11 20:51:18 -07:00
  • 6e0c185988 docs/devel: Fix link to developer mailing lists Bernhard Beschow 2022-05-20 20:01:09 +02:00
  • ea7c452783 accel/tcg: Inline dump_opcount_info() and remove it Bernhard Beschow 2022-05-20 20:01:08 +02:00
  • c304d11f45 accel/tcg/cpu-exec: Unexport dump_drift_info() Bernhard Beschow 2022-05-20 20:01:07 +02:00
  • b1f66fab45 hw/mips/boston: Initialize g_autofree pointers Bernhard Beschow 2022-06-05 17:19:08 +02:00
  • 8b7f856e9d Merge tag 'mips-20220611' of https://github.com/philmd/qemu into staging Richard Henderson 2022-06-11 08:18:55 -07:00
  • 37da3bcf01 docs/devel: Fix link to developer mailing lists Bernhard Beschow 2022-05-20 20:01:09 +02:00
  • b01841fa85 accel/tcg: Inline dump_opcount_info() and remove it Bernhard Beschow 2022-05-20 20:01:08 +02:00
  • 7112ffd93a accel/tcg/cpu-exec: Unexport dump_drift_info() Bernhard Beschow 2022-05-20 20:01:07 +02:00
  • 3d9641509a hw/net/fsl_etsec/etsec: Remove obsolete and unused etsec_create() Bernhard Beschow 2022-05-20 20:01:06 +02:00